Boston Braves camp, Macon GA, 1914. The future Miracle-makers are deciding they don't actually need Walt Tragesser (left), who played 2 games for them in 1913, but will spend this season with Birmingham of the Southern Association, or Frank Bruggy (who will go back to the Lawrence [MA] Barristers of the Northeast League for another season, and not reach the majors until the 1921 Phillies)…but for the moment, they feel like big-leaguers, getting photographed by Underwood & Underwood here.

(The "B" on the uniforms is red, according to Dressed to the Nines. Presumably it showed up a bit better against the blue road uniforms IRL than we can see on Tragesser, here.)
